"Fludd: a novel" is a book by contemporary writer Hilary Mantel about the life and fate of the main character, a settlement chaplain in a small English town. The story takes place in the mid-1950s, when the country was still reeling from the effects of World War II.
In this book, the author explores the topic of spirituality, faith and doubt through the lens of deep reflection and an inner search for light. In her writings, a realistic picture of everyday circumstances is combined with elements of fantasy, forcing the reader to rethink his own beliefs and views on reality.
"Fludd: a novel" is a complex and exquisite work that fascinates with its depth and unexpected turns of events. Readers will be able to feel the tension between hope and reality, believing that true light will always find its way through the darkness."
